Medicare | USAGov
Medicare is the federal health insurance program for people: Age 65 or older. Under 65 with certain disabilities. Any age with end-stage renal disease. This is permanent kidney failure requiring dialysis or a kidney transplant. Medicare has four parts: Part A is hospital insurance. Part B is medical insurance.

Medicare Benefits | SSA
Medicare is our country's health insurance program for people age 65 or older. Certain people younger than age 65 can qualify for Medicare too, including those with disabilities and those who have permanent kidney failure. The program helps with the cost of health care, but it does not cover all medical expenses or the cost of most long-term care.
